Description
19TH-CENTURY FRENCH SILVER SPOON IN CASE: Approx. 2.52 Troy ounces. Finely detailed French, (.950) Silver Spoon, having a Pierced Floral urn & Foliate, Gold-washed bowl. Handle has a Torch, Bow, & Arrow motif. Impressed makers marks at bowl rim. Made by Edouard Ernie, Paris, Circa 1890. Approx. 7.75" l x 2.5" w. Presentation case Approx. 1.5" h z 9" l x 3.5" w.
Condition
Wear to case.
